Jump to content

Recommended Posts

Posted

Прошу помощи.

Неполучается настроить виртуальные хосты (stat и admin)

 

Имею ASPLinux9 Bind9 и Apache

имею скажем IP=192.168.1.1

 

файл mynet.ru.host выглядит

.......

mynet.ru IN NS mynet.ru

mynet.ru IN A 192.168.1.1

stat.mynet.ru IN CNAME mynet.ru

admin.mynet.ru IN CNAME mynet.ru

 

В результат пинг с клиента

ping http://mynet.ru - есть!!!

ping http://stat.mynet.ru - НЕТ!!!

ping http://admin.mynet.ru - НЕТ!!!

 

с сервера ни однин адрес не пингуется.

Posted

точку в конце незабывай

 

должно быть типа этого:

mynet.ru IN NS mynet.ru.

mynet.ru IN A 192.168.1.1

stat.mynet.ru IN CNAME mynet.ru.

admin.mynet.ru IN CNAME mynet.ru.

 

ps. и еще есть замечательная утилита dig

Posted
точку в конце незабывай

 

должно быть типа этого:

mynet.ru IN NS mynet.ru.

mynet.ru IN A 192.168.1.1

stat.mynet.ru IN CNAME mynet.ru.

admin.mynet.ru IN CNAME mynet.ru.

 

ps. и еще есть замечательная утилита dig

 

Точку в конце не забывай ;)

 

Должно быть:

 

mynet.ru. IN NS mynet.ru.

mynet.ru. IN A 192.168.1.1

stat.mynet.ru. IN CNAME mynet.ru.

admin.mynet.ru. IN CNAME mynet.ru.

Posted

Вроде как BIND настроил, по крайней мере ping stat.mynet.ru проходит, а вот с клиента nslookup stat.mynet.ru выдаёт следующее:

 

C:Documents and Settingsdmitry>nslookup stat.mynet.ru

DNS request timed out.

timeout was 2 seconds.

*** Can't find server name for address 192.168.1.1: Timed out

*** Default servers are not available

Server: UnKnown <-- ????????????????????

Address: 192.168.1.1

 

DNS request timed out.

timeout was 2 seconds.

Name: srv1.mynet.ru

Address: 192.168.1.1

Aliases: stat.mynet.ru

 

Что надо сделать, чтобы сервер был известен. Я делал так:

hostname -v srv1

и ещё так

/etc/rc.local srv1

 

 

1.Может надо как-то по другому присваивать имя компутеру, или ещё что-то где-то прописывать???

 

2.И почему срабатывает только ping stat.mynet.ru

а

ping http://stat.mynet.ru уже нет ???

 

Вот мои файлы:

HOSTS

------------------------------

127.0.0.1 localhost

192.168.1.1 srv1

------------------------------

 

HOST.CONF

------------------------------

order hosts,bind

------------------------------

 

RESOLV.CONF

------------------------------

search srv1.mynet.ru mynet.ru

nameserver 192.168.1.1

nameserver 127.0.0.1

------------------------------

Posted

1. имя пропиши здесь /etc/hostname

У меня ASPLinux 9, в дирректории /еtс файла hostname НЕТ!!!

2. firewall есть?

НЕТ!!!

3. дай полное описание зоны

 

1.168.192.rev

-------------------------------------------------------------------------------------------

$ttl 38400

1.168.192.in-addr.arpa. IN SOA srv1.mynet.ru. user.srv1.mynet.ru. (

1019064428

10800

3600

604800

38400 )

1.168.192.in-addr.arpa. IN NS srv1.mynet.ru.

1.1.168.192.in-addr.arpa. IN PTR srv1.mynet.ru.

-------------------------------------------------------------------------------------------

 

mynet.ru.hosts

-------------------------------------------------------------------------------------------

$ttl 38400

mynet.ru. IN SOA srv1.mynet.ru. user.srv1.mynet.ru. (

1019064898

10800

3600

604800

38400 )

mynet.ru. IN NS srv1.mynet.ru.

srv1.mynet.ru. IN A 192.168.1.1

mynet.ru. IN MX 0 srv1.mynet.ru.

stat.mynet.ru. IN CNAME srv1.mynet.ru.

-------------------------------------------------------------------------------------------

 

named.conf

-------------------------------------------------------------------------------------------

options {

directory "/etc";

pid-file "/var/run/named/named.pid";

};

zone "0.0.127.in-addr.arpa" {

type master;

file "/etc/named.local";

};

 

zone "1.168.192.in-addr.arpa" {

type master;

file "/etc/1.168.192.rev";

};

 

zone "mynet.ru" {

type master;

file "/etc/mynet.ru.hosts";

};

-------------------------------------------------------------------------------------------

 

named.local

-------------------------------------------------------------------------------------------

$TTL 1d

@ IN SOA localhost. root.localhost. (

1997022700 ; Serial

28800 ; Refresh

14400 ; Retry

3600000 ; Expire

86400 ) ; Minimum

IN NS localhost.

 

1 IN PTR localhost.

-------------------------------------------------------------------------------------------

  • 3 weeks later...
Posted

/etc/hosts

192.168.1.1 srv1.mynet.ru

192.168.1.1 stat.mynet.ru

и т.д.

 

Но не уверен.

 

100% работает

/etc/hosts

192.168.1.1 srv1.mynet.ru

192.168.1.2 stat.mynet.ru

 

и указываеш алиасом интерфейс 1.2 на 1.1

ifconfig eth0:1 192.168.1.2

eth0 - интерфейс, где у тебя 1.1

Posted
Блин, скока мутотени с BIND.

DjbDns ( http://cr.yp.to/djbdns.html ) несравнимо проще в настройке, плюс абсолютно безопасен ( http://cr.yp.to/djbdns/guarantee.html )

Товарищ Бернштейн не только делает безопасные программы, но и имеет свой, неповторимый взгляд на то, как нужно соблюдать стандарты.

Posted

Stanislav, полносью согласен.

Mish!, никакой "мутотени" (хм.. хорошее словечко) нет, bind настраиваться за минут 15, причем секурнось его меня вполне устаивает.

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...
На сайте используются файлы cookie и сервисы аналитики для корректной работы форума и улучшения качества обслуживания. Продолжая использовать сайт, вы соглашаетесь с использованием файлов cookie и с Политикой конфиденциальности.